There are a few criteria that a tourist takes into account before visiting a country –
Climate – India is a year-round country. Every season offers something special to the tourists.
Infrastructure – Almost all sights in India offer good train, road or flight options and also good entertainment options.
Political stability – The largest democracy in the world is politically stable not only in the center but also in almost all the states. Political developments do not affect daily lives of the people.
Security – With some precautions and simple awareness, the concern of security is not a major concern when it comes to traveling in India.
Cost-Efficiency – India is one of the most economical countries when it comes to currency exchange and spending.
On all these criteria, India stands high and therefore becomes a favorite place for a tourist.
Despite all the measures taken by the government, there is still a lot of room for improvement to boost tourism in India. Here are some suggestions that can lead to improvement in tourism in India:-
Infrastructure improvement – In many places in India there is a lack of good infrastructure for tourism. They demand better connectivity and health care, especially for the disabled, the elderly and children.
With better infrastructure, telephone and internet connections, people can access the help of security and health personnel in emergencies.
Hygiene and Cleanliness – Many tourist places and famous monuments lack cleanliness and proper sanitation. A sufficient number of washrooms and toilets must be provided in such places. Changing rooms should also be set up on beaches and near other bodies of water so that tourists, especially women, feel comfortable while changing.
Updating Tourist Websites – The official tourist websites in India should be updated to clearly inform tourists about various things.
Vocal for Local – Tourists should use local products, travel by public transport. You should especially stay in remote and small places with local hosts. The central and state governments should also try to encourage domestic tourists to travel more in India and explore their own country.
With all these measures, tourism in India can be expected to witness a new peak. Both domestic and foreign tourists will discover India’s hidden treasures in terms of landscape, culture, cuisine and spirituality.
